Frequently Asked Questions
Are these cables suitable for 10-Gigabit Ethernet?
Cat6 cables support 10GBASE-T at distances up to 55 meters, and at 0.5 feet these are well within that range, so yes, they can handle 10-Gigabit connections.
What is the conductor material in these cables?
They use pure bare copper wire, not copper-clad aluminum, which provides superior conductivity and meets proper Cat6 electrical specifications.
Do the connectors have boot covers to prevent snagging?
Yes, each RJ45 connector includes a snagless strain relief boot that protects the locking tab and prevents it from catching on adjacent cables or ports.
Can I use these cables for Power over Ethernet (PoE)?
Yes, the pure copper conductors and 24AWG wire gauge make them capable of carrying PoE power to compatible devices such as access points and IP cameras.
